Output 91b18f3072ead2a795f79de2c3450bada7760c92af660de2dad077d590541589:1

value
20611755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ec16f5c35913a3dcb5bca00b869f67b501cb111 OP_EQUAL
address
MLuyumb84gsMkL7bETgFrzpYfrwtzFswtB
transaction
91b18f3072ead2a795f79de2c3450bada7760c92af660de2dad077d590541589
spent
true